📜  python 元组相乘序列 - Python (1)

📅  最后修改于: 2023-12-03 15:04:15.168000             🧑  作者: Mango

Python 元组相乘序列

在Python中,元组是不可变序列,意味着元组中的元素不能被修改。然而,我们可以使用乘法操作符*来生成一个包含多个相同元素的新元组。此外,我们还可以使用加法操作符+将两个元组合并成一个新元组。

元组的乘法操作符

使用*操作符,我们可以创建一个新的元组,其中包含相同元素重复多次。

t = (1, 2, 3) * 3
print(t)  # 输出 (1, 2, 3, 1, 2, 3, 1, 2, 3)

在这个例子中,我们将元素(1, 2, 3)重复了3次生成了一个新的元组。注意,原始元组本身没有被修改。

元组的加法操作符

使用+操作符,我们可以合并两个元组成为一个新的元组。

t1 = (1, 2, 3)
t2 = (4, 5, 6)
t3 = t1 + t2
print(t3)  # 输出 (1, 2, 3, 4, 5, 6)

在这个例子中,我们将t1t2合并成了一个新的元组t3。注意,原始元组t1t2本身并没有被修改。

总结

在Python中,我们可以使用*操作符来生成包含多个相同元素的元组,还可以使用+操作符将两个元组合并成为一个新的元组。这些操作都是非常实用的,能够在实际编程中派上大用场。